## Authentication

Heads up: the nightly reindex job (`reindex_nightly.py`) talks to the Lanternfish search cluster, and that cluster won't accept anonymous writes anymore — we locked it down last sprint. The job now authenticates as the `reindex-runner` service identity against Corvid Gateway, and the token is injected via the `LF_INDEX_TOKEN` env var in the scheduler config. Nothing clever going on, just a bearer header on every batch request. For review purposes, the staging credential currently in use is listed below.

service key, kadug-kadup: kto15_rN23XLAYImmZgrJ

Onboarding Note — Marrowbell Bakery Platform

Release managers must understand the order-cutoff rule: the Ovenline service freezes all bakery orders at 14:00 local so production schedules lock cleanly. Never ship a release that crosses the cutoff window, as in-flight orders may duplicate. If a deploy must happen near cutoff, pause the queue first. To unlock the queue-pause console, enter the recovery passphrase shown below.

unlock words, yadup-yagef: zorael-druix

Escalation: if the Ratchet migration (our old homegrown job queue moving to Beltline) stalls mid-cutover, don't roll back yourself — the dual-write window means you'd drop jobs. Page the migration lead first. Security note: Beltline workers run with the legacy queue's creds until phase 3, so any anomaly there is a page, not a ticket. For cred-related questions, reach the migration security contact below.

escalation mailbox, badug-tawip: ulaath@nelvroforge.example

Board Briefing: Retirement of the Quillstone Product Line

Quillstone revenues have declined for six consecutive quarters, and maintenance costs now exceed contribution margin. Management recommends a phased retirement over twelve months, with migration support toward the Averline platform. Customer notifications begin after board approval. Headcount impacts are minimal and handled through reassignment. The strategic context is set out in the note below.

management briefing: Project Ulavan slips by two quarters because of the staffing delay.